Types of Welder’s Certifications
Although the American Welding Society’s standard CW (Certified Welder) card helps make you eligible for the majority of positions, certain industries will require their own specific certification. Several of the most-common of these are listed below.
- American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for individuals who work on boiler and pressurized containers
- Certified Welder Certification to be a Certified Welder
- API Certification for individuals that work with pipelines in the gas and oil industry
- Certified Welding Instructor and Senior Certified Welding Instructor Certification for inspectors and senior inspectors

The below table illustrates wages and employment forecasts for professional welders in Georgia through 2022.
| Georgia | Employment | |||
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2012 | 2022 | Change | Annual Job Openings | |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ers | 7,750 | 9,200 | 19% | 340 |
| Georgia | Annual Salary | ||
|---|---|---|---|
| Low | Median | High | |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ers |
$22,300 | $33,800 | $48,700 |
Source: O*Net Online
Welder Schools – The Things to Anticipate
There are a number of terrific programs to opt for, but you need to ensure the welding schools you wish to sign-up for meet specific standards. You could possibly hear that welding training are all similar, however there are some things you may want to be aware of before deciding on which welder schools to register for in Greenwood Estates, GA. The training programs that you intend to sign up for should be accepted by a national regulatory agency such as the American Welding Society . After looking into the accreditation situation, you will want to investigate a little bit further to make sure that the program you are considering can supply you with the correct training.
- Be certain the college trains with gear that matches up-to-date industry requirements
- Find out if the program offers financial support
- Make certain that the school’s curriculum offers classes in pipe welding, GTAW, GMAW, and SMAW
- Search for courses that fulfill AWS SENSE standards
